For courses in computerprogramming. Evaluates the fundamentals ofcontemporary computer programming languages Concepts of Computer ProgrammingLanguages introduces students to the fundamental concepts of computerprogramming languages and provides them with the tools necessary to evaluatecontemporary and future languages. Through a critical analysis of designissues, the text teaches students the essential differences between computingwith specific languages, while the in-depth discussion of programming languagestructures also prepares them to study compiler design. The 12thEdition includes new material on contemporary languages like Swift andPython, replacing discussions of outdated languages.
